Transponder Keys

If your car is manufactured within the recent 20 years or so the chances are that it comes with a transponder key (also called a "chip" key). The key's head is equipped with a transponder in it. When the key is inserted into the ignition, an antenna ring transmits radio frequency energy. This chip then responds with an identification code. The message is then relayed to the vehicle's immobilizer, and if the correct code is present then the engine will be able to start.

If the correct code doesn't exist, the immobilizer will deactivate and prevent the car from beginning. Transponder keys aid in preventing car theft by adding an extra layer of security. Remote Fobs

Many cars come with remotes that allow drivers to open trunks, doors, and tailgates. Some remotes can even start the vehicle. These tiny wireless devices communicate with the vehicle through radio signals and operate on the power of batteries. However, if the fob's battery fails, it can make the device inoperable.

A chirp is usually a sign that the key fob battery needs replacing, and most of these remotes come with easy-to-open cases. Once you have opened the case, you'll have to locate the correct replacement battery. The majority of these batteries can be found in auto parts stores and some supermarkets.

Reassembling the key fob is necessary after you've replaced the battery. Utilizing a screwdriver that has a flat blade to gently open the fob in various places to ensure that the shell isn't damaged. Re-snap the fob and test all buttons. If all is well, you're done!

If, however, the fob still isn't functioning it could be more serious than a defective battery. It could have lost car key replacement near me its program, and the locksmith or dealer may be required to repair it.

The majority of fobs have an option to reset the programming. The process is generally quick however it is dependent on the car model and make. The key fob will need to be "programmed" again to send its digital identity code to the car's onboard computer. This process is different for each car model and year, but it generally involves engaging the car's power source (often multiple times) while holding different levers or buttons.
